Update...
Had another crash, so I attempted to do a rollback, disable mods, reinstall patch and re-enable mods, hence I was able to get the names of the files that were remaining in the "Backups" folder which 1.02 patch was complaining about still being enabled.
They were simply the Bgrnd1.tga files installed by the Dials mods I'd previously used, and were set to "read only" which I would imagine caused them to not be disabled by jsgme when the mods were disabled.
I guess "good housekeeping" will now consist of checking EVERY files attributes before allowing jsgme to touch them.
Total bummer for those of us that DO try to maintain a healthy install.

Lightning61 02-22-07 09:25 PM

Update...
After a full reinstall with the only old files being my copy&paste of my career back into My Documents/SH3, things seem to have been due to something wrong in the last save I made in patrol 10, which was begun fresh from Lorient after 1.02 installation.
The newest save, (which was made middle of nowhere on surface), still refused to load.
I then exited the sim, re-booted, and decided to sacrifice the newest save, since it didn't contain any sinkings.
All seems to be functioning fine now, (3 sinkings @ 20,000+ tons later)! :D

So, if you have trouble loading a saved career, try just backing up one save slot before going through all the BS I did! :up:
